PM greets Sikkim Chief Minister Chamling on his birthday

New Delhi, Sep 22 (UNI)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Saturday extended birthday greetings to the Sikkim Chief Minister Pawan Kumar Chamling.
"Birthday greetings to Sikkim CM Shri Pawan Chamling Ji. For over two decades he’s been tirelessly working for Sikkim’s growth. I pray for his long and healthy life," Mr Modi tweeted.
On April 29 this year Mr Chamling created a history for himself as he surpassed the record of former West Bengal Chief Minister Jyoti Basu by becoming the longest serving Chief Minister of any state in the country.

Mr Chamling, who is also the president of his regional outfit Sikkim Democratic Front (SDF) had first become Chief Minister on December 12, 1994 and has not looked behind since then.
The Marxist veteran Jyoti Basu ruled West Bengal for 23 years from June 21, 1977 till November 6, 2000 before he gave up the post to his handpicked Buddhadeb Bhattacharjee.
